Description
Located in a prime seafront position with direct access to dunes and enjoying far-reaching panoramic views across the English Channel. The nearby New Romney, one of the historic Cinque Ports, offers a variety of independent shops, cafés and restaurants together with a Sainsbury’s store. Both primary and secondary schooling can be found within the area, while leisure facilities include the nearby Littlestone Golf Club, the popular The Pilot Inn and the renowned Dungeness National Nature Reserve, all just a short drive away. The larger market town of Ashford is also easily accessible, providing a more extensive range of shopping and leisure amenities along with high-speed rail services from Ashford International railway station, offering journey times to London St Pancras International in under 40 minutes. Travelling east along the coast leads to the neighbouring towns of Hythe and Folkestone, which provide convenient access to the Channel Tunnel Terminal, the Port of Dover and the M20 motorway, while to the west lies the historic town and harbour of Rye.
